In the Egyptian Premier League Relegation Group, trader consensus reflects a razor-thin contest for Ghazl El Mahalla SC's home clash against second-placed Wadi Degla SC on April 13, with implied probabilities tightly clustered around 50% due to balanced dynamics. Ghazl, sitting 9th, leverages El Mahalla Stadium home advantage and recent defensive solidity—drawing 1-1 at National Bank of Egypt on March 21 and 0-0 versus ENPPI—offsetting their earlier 3-2 loss to Wadi Degla in January. Wadi Degla's momentum from a 3-1 League Cup win over Tala'ea El Gaish on March 25 and strong away form (including 2-1 at Ismaily) keeps them competitive, but frequent head-to-head draws (3 of last 8) and mutual low-scoring trends (under 2.5 goals in 7 of Ghazl's last 10) sustain the draw's near-even pricing amid high relegation stakes.
